Job Description


Senior Engineer responsibilities include:

  • Takes ownership for validating the project’s statement of work and contract terms with the customer, including both technical and commercial elements, becomes lead contact for customer for balance of project order. (Project Initiation).
  • Develops a project schedule and communicates with the customer to ensure expectations are being met. Direct engagement with internal manufacturing facilities and third-party vendors. (Project Planning).
  • Monitor the execution of the customer’s project order, verifying execution of the project through kick-off meetings, communication to all parties and exchange of technical requirements and project plan information, performance of factory acceptance, site acceptance, site energization preparation. (Project Execution)
  • Lead the monitor and control of the performance of the customer’s project through its lifecycle. Key activities include task completion verification, project team monitoring, managing the exchange of project updates across the project team members, schedule reporting, issue resolution, and contract administration. (Monitor and Control Project Work)
  • Lead the closeout of the customer’s project to include financial reconciliation, verification of job site equipment arrival, installation, start-up, and training support completion through review of internal system information, contact with the customer, and coordination with support services such as field services, after-shipment support, and training functions. (Project Close)
